Stability

While a fold-in treadmill can be a great option for people with limited space, it's essential to choose a model that is sturdy enough to withstand the strain of your exercise. Avoid models with weak pivots or folding mechanisms, since they could easily break when under pressure. It is also important to consider the length of time you'll be using the machine, as it can influence the stability of the machine.

Many people prefer a non-folding treadmill because they provide more stability than a folding treadmill. They typically have a larger motor that can withstand more weight and provide a smooth, consistent workout. Additionally, they are simpler to move, which can be beneficial if you want to use it in multiple places around the house. However, these machines can be more expensive than a treadmill that folds due to the fact that they require more components.

A great way to test the stability of a treadmill is to test it at different speeds and on different surfaces. You can also test how the treadmill fold up adapts to changes in speed and how it handles high-intensity intervals. It's also crucial to evaluate the weight and ensure that it meets your requirements.

homefitnesscode-folding-treadmill-2-in-1-under-desk-treadmill-with-bluetooth-speaker-installation-free-1-10km-h-speed-range-and-led-display-electric-treadmills-for-home-office-black-57.jpgMany of the most popular treadmills for folding feature a hinged design which allows them to be folded flat. This type of folding is referred to as the fold-on-pin (FOP) design, and it's the most popular in the industry. This design is simple to use, but it could affect the mechanical stability.

Another problem with this type of treadmill is that the legs aren't locked into position when the machine is closed, which could cause the treadmill to tilt when you're running. This can result in irregular strides and poor posture which could result in injury. This problem can be solved by purchasing a treadmill that features a lockable console.

Cleaning is simple

Many treadmills that fold are a little bit easier to clean than non-folding models. The folding models are lighter and can be moved around your home or apartment with a vacuum cleaner attachment. If you're limited on space in your home, a folding treadmill may be the right choice for you.

Generally speaking, your treadmill should be cleaned every when you are done using it. Dirt, sweat, and sweat can cause permanent damage to a treadmill if they're not removed promptly. You'll be able to see that your treadmill will last longer if you maintain regular cleaning. The manual for your treadmill will outline a specific routine. However generally, you should clean the motor, deck as well as any built-in electronic components.

You will also need to lubricate your deck regularly, particularly if you use it frequently. This helps reduce the amount of friction which can damage the deck. The user manual will provide more information.

When you're not using your treadmill, make sure to keep it in a climate-controlled space. This will prevent rust and mold from accumulating on the machine and make it easier to clean. It is a good idea to read the instruction manual for your treadmill, and then consult a professional should you have any concerns about storing your treadmill correctly.

Folding treadmills have many advantages over non-folding ones. One of the benefits is that they take up less space in storage. This is perfect for those who live in smaller houses or in apartments. Furthermore, many treadmills that fold have wheels for transport on the bottom, making it easier to move them from room to room. However, despite their small size, these machines can still offer great workouts and plenty of features that are similar to full-size treadmills.

When selecting a fold-in treadmill, think about what kind of exercises you prefer to do. If you plan to run on it, make sure the treadmill is capable of supporting your weight and provides numerous speed ranges. Some treadmills also have incline settings which can increase the intensity of your workout and help burn more calories.

The right treadmill for your budget is also important. Although some of the top folding treadmills can cost more than traditional models however, there are plenty of affordable options available. City L6 by ProForm is a great choice for those who are first-time buyers of treadmills because of its low cost and innovative fold system. The treadmill folds the monitor flat against the deck instead of folding it when it's not being used. It can be tucked away under a desk or sofa.

Certain treadmills with fold-in features have safety features built-in to help prevent injuries or accidents during your exercise. For example, some feature a built-in emergency stop clip which shuts off the machine's belt in the event of a fall or slip. Others have sensors that detect motion and automatically slow the belt's speed if not paying attention to your surroundings.
